Recently constructed detached family home with all the advantages of a new build property in great location for the popular Langley Park schools and Unicorn Primary. High specification finish and current owners have paid great attention to detail ensuring a buyer can move in and enjoy the well planned accommodation over three floors with the upgrade of fitted blinds and Hive central heating controls. Stunning open plan kitchen/living room with bi-fold doors to landscaped rear garden with extensive terrace. Utility room, spacious cloakroom and downstairs study, in addition to FOUR BEDROOMS, giving good space to work from home. Beautiful bathrooms including two en suites, full double glazing and gas central heating. Plot size affords driveway parking and attached garage with through access via electric front and rear doors facilitating easy access to wider garden with possible extra parking space.



Accessed via Tiber Way, off South Eden Park Road by the Beckenham Park Care Home, this property is at the far end of Roman Way opposite the lake and there is a children's play area near by off Romulus Drive.  As the crow flies, this end of the road is closest to the popular Langley Park Primary and Secondary Schools as well as Unicorn Primary.  The Super Loop bus route runs along South Eden Park Road and Eden Park Station provides trains to London Bridge and The City.  Local sporting facilities include Park Langley Tennis Club, Langley Park Golf Club and David Lloyd Leisure Club on Stanhope Grove. Local shops are available on Wickham Road, by the Park Langley roundabout along with a Tesco Express.
